ZUCCHINI WITH EGG



Zucchini with Egg image

This is a dish my grandparents used to make. It is so simple, yet it is so yummy! It is great in the summer and even better with homegrown zucchini.

Provided by Kristy

Categories     100+ Breakfast and Brunch Recipes     Eggs     Scrambled Egg Recipes

Time 20m

Yield 2

Number Of Ingredients 5

1 ½ tablespoons olive oil
2 large zucchini, cut into large chunks
salt and ground black pepper to taste
2 large eggs
1 teaspoon water, or as desired

Steps:

  • Heat oil in a skillet over medium-high heat; saute zucchini until tender, about 10 minutes. Season zucchini with salt and black pepper.
  • Beat eggs with a fork in a bowl; add water and beat until evenly combined. Pour eggs over zucchini; cook and stir until eggs are scrambled and no longer runny, about 5 minutes. Season zucchini and eggs with salt and black pepper.

ZUCCHINI AND EGGS



Zucchini and Eggs image

This protein-packed zucchini & eggs recipe is a delicious way to start the day; to mix things up, you can also add feta and dill to make it Greek-style.

Provided by Capri S. Cafaro

Categories     Breakfast

Time 35m

Number Of Ingredients 6

4 tablespoons extra virgin olive oil
1/2 cup (3 oz) yellow onion (thinly sliced)
1 clove garlic (minced)
2 medium (10 oz) zucchini (diced)
4 large eggs (beaten)
Salt and freshly ground black pepper

Steps:

  • In a skillet over medium-low heat, warm 2 tablespoons oil, add the onions and sauté until slightly translucent, about 4 minutes.
  • Add the garlic and zucchini to the skillet and cook until the zucchini is browned, increasing the heat if needed, and stirring occasionally, 5 to 10 minutes. Use a slotted spoon to move the vegetables to a paper towel-lined plate to drain and discard any excess oil.
  • Set the skillet over medium heat, add the remaining 2 tablespoons oil, then stir the vegetable mixture back into the skillet.
  • Pour the eggs into the skillet and scramble with the vegetables until done to your liking, 3 to 5 minutes.
  • Season to taste with salt and pepper and serve immediately.

ZUCCHINI AND EGG TART WITH FRESH HERBS



Zucchini and Egg Tart With Fresh Herbs image

Store-bought puff pastry makes easy work of this colorful tart, adapted from "The Modern Cook's Year," a vegetarian cookbook by the British author Anna Jones. When you're rolling out puff pastry, thin flatbread or any other flattened dough, invert the baking sheet so you can unfurl the dough directly on it without the rim getting in the way of your rolling pin. Then parbake the tart without toppings first so that the base cooks through before it's slathered with crème fraîche, piled with a mess of vegetables and eggs, and returned to the oven to finish. (You'll want to bake just until the whites of the eggs start to look glossy and custardy, not firm.) Top with any torn, tender herbs you have on hand, like small parsley sprigs, chives, tarragon or dill, cut into quarters, and serve warm.

Provided by Alexa Weibel

Categories     breakfast, brunch, pies and tarts, main course

Time 1h

Yield 4 servings

Number Of Ingredients 11

5 large eggs
1 (14-ounce) package frozen puff pastry, thawed
2 medium zucchini (6 to 7 ounces each), sliced lengthwise into 6 slabs, about 1/4-inch-thick each
8 scallions, trimmed
1 tablespoon plus 1 teaspoon extra-virgin olive oil
Kosher salt and black pepper
1/3 cup crème fraîche or mascarpone
1 tablespoon Dijon mustard
1/2 teaspoon freshly grated lemon zest
1/3 cup frozen peas, thawed
Any combination of fresh tarragon, small parsley or dill sprigs, and chopped chives, for garnish

Steps:

  • Heat the oven to 425 degrees. Beat one egg in a small bowl for egg wash.
  • On an inverted baking sheet, unfold the puff pastry to lay it out flat. Cut the puff pastry into a 10-by-12-inch rectangle, rolling out and trimming excess as needed. Slice a 3/4-inch strip from the perimeter of the puff pastry from each of the four sides. Brush the remaining puff pastry with the egg wash then prick every few inches of the surface with a fork to prevent puffing. Place the pastry strips along the edge of all four sides to form a border that is raised like the edges of a picture frame, gently pressing to seal. Trim the excess and brush border with egg wash.
  • On a second baking sheet, gently toss the zucchini and scallions with 1 tablespoon oil; season with salt and pepper. Transfer both baking sheets to the oven (the sheet holding the puff pastry should still be inverted) and bake until vegetables are softened and pastry is puffed and golden, removing the vegetables after 10 minutes and the puff pastry after 20 to 25 minutes. Press the pastry's puffed center gently with your fingertips to deflate.
  • Stir the crème fraîche, mustard and lemon zest in a small bowl and season with salt and pepper. Working within the border, brush the mixture over the pastry. Halve the zucchini crosswise at an angle. Arrange the zucchini and scallions on the surface of the pastry, draping the zucchini on its side and reinforcing with the scallions to create four circular nests to hold the eggs.
  • Crack each of the remaining four eggs into a small cup then transfer to a nest in the puff pastry. In a small bowl, toss the peas with the remaining 1 teaspoon oil and season with salt and pepper. Avoiding the eggs, sprinkle the tart with the peas. Bake until the egg whites are opaque and custardy and yolks are still runny, about 20 minutes. Season the eggs with salt and pepper and top with torn fresh herbs. Cut the tart into quarters and serve immediately.

ZUCCHINI AND WHITE BEAN CAESAR



Zucchini and White Bean Caesar image

Ribbons of raw zucchini take well to the Caesar treatment in mostly no-cook dinner. If you have lots of summer squash, this easy summer meal is the answer.

Provided by Rebecca Firkser

Time 30m

Yield 4 servings

Number Of Ingredients 14

½ small loaf crusty bread (such as country-style, ciabatta, or baguette)
⅔ cup extra-virgin olive oil, divided; plus more for serving (optional)
½ tsp. Diamond Crystal or ¼ tsp. Morton kosher salt, divided, plus more
Freshly ground black pepper
2 large egg yolks*
2 large garlic cloves, finely grated
1 tsp. finely grated lemon zest, plus more for serving
¼ cup fresh lemon juice
3 tsp. Dijon mustard
3 oil-packed anchovy fillets
1½ oz. Parmesan, finely grated, plus more for serving
1½ lb. zucchini (about 6 medium), shaved into ribbons lengthwise with a vegetable peeler
1 15.5-oz. can white beans (such as cannellini, butter, or navy), rinsed, patted dry
Lemon wedges (for serving)

Steps:

  • Tear ½ small loaf crusty bread (such as country-style, ciabatta, or baguette) into 1" pieces (you should have about 4 cups). Heat ⅓ cup extra-virgin olive oil in a large skillet over medium-high. Add bread and season with kosher salt and freshly ground black pepper. Cook, tossing occasionally, until golden brown and crisp on all sides, about 5 minutes. Transfer to a plate.
  • Whisk together 2 large egg yolks*, 2 large garlic cloves, finely grated, 1 tsp. finely grated lemon zest, ¼ cup fresh lemon juice, and 3 tsp. Dijon mustard in a medium bowl. Whisking constantly, gradually pour in ⅓ cup extra-virgin olive oil, starting drop by drop and increasing to a steady stream. (To keep the bowl from sliding as you whisk, set inside a snugly fitting saucepan or wrap a damp kitchen towel around base of bowl to stabilize.) Whisk until mixture is emulsified and achieves a consistency between heavy cream and mayonnaise. (Alternatively, you can use a food processor, first pulsing egg yolk mixture together, then running the motor while you gradually stream in oil.)
  • Finely chop 3 oil-packed anchovy fillets, then sprinkle with salt and use the side of your knife to mash into a paste; scrape into egg yolk mixture. Add 1½ oz. Parmesan, finely grated, ½ tsp. Diamond Crystal or ¼ tsp. kosher salt, and lots of pepper; whisk to combine. Taste dressing and season with more salt and pepper if needed (dressing should be pretty assertive-we're about to add lots of bread, zucchini, and beans).
  • Place croutons, 1½ lb. zucchini (about 6 medium), shaved into ribbons lengthwise with a vegetable peeler, and one 15.5-oz. can white beans (such as cannellini, butter, or navy), rinsed, patted dry, in a large bowl; drizzle with dressing and toss gently to coat.
  • Divide salad among plates and top with more Parmesan and lemon zest, season with more pepper, and drizzle with more oil if desired. Serve with lemon wedges for squeezing over. *Raw egg is not recommended for infants, the elderly, pregnant women, people with weakened immune systems...or people who don't like raw eggs. Just use coddled egg yolks instead if needed.
